Output f21778e16bbb1473628e259442137ddf5f00deb2520e08159a8d02ed60c9aecb:1

value
40843049
script pubkey
OP_HASH160 OP_PUSHBYTES_20 301a8c252b55f631d67fc4278aa7a59b3b5f289f OP_EQUAL
address
365NAJNEZjtgdM98CVC5KYJPqZhX66otaT
transaction
f21778e16bbb1473628e259442137ddf5f00deb2520e08159a8d02ed60c9aecb
confirmations
334752
spent
true